Verbalizable Representations Form a Global Workspace in Language Models transformer-circuits.pub
AI Weekly's analysis
  • Anthropic's interpretability team introduces the Jacobian lens, which isolates internal vectors that encode a token the model could verbalize next.
  • The reported 'J-space' workspace accounts for no more than roughly 10% of activation variance and appears only in the middle block of the network.
  • Training Claude to articulate ethical principles when interrupted reportedly improved behavior in uninterrupted contexts, with no direct training on the behavior itself.
